Quick Installation Guide Wireless Network Broadband Router WL-114 This guide only covers the most common situations. See the complete User's Manual on the CD - ROM for advanced configuration Requirements · Cable modem or DSL/ADSL modem. · Standard 10/100BaseT (UTP) network cables with RJ45 connectors. · PCs with TCP/IP network protocol. Setting up the broadband router 1 Physical installation 1 For the installation of the Broadband router it is assumed that you have at least one PC with a working broadband Internet connection. It is also assumed that the modem is configured in accordance with the requirements of your ISP and of the modem manufacturer. If not, consult your ISP support literature. 2 Before you begin, ensure that the power lead is not connected to either the broadband router or the cable modem/DSL modem. Leave your cable modem/DSL modem plugged in (telephone line or cable input). 3 Connect the LAN cables: For the WL-114, use standard LAN cables to connect the PCs to the LAN ports (hub) on the broadband router. 4. Connect your cable modem/DSL modem to the WAN -port on the broadband router. Use the cable supplied with your cable modem/DSL modem. If no cable was supplied with your modem, use a standard network cable. 5. Switch on the cable modem/DSL modem. 6. Connect the power supply adapter to the broadband router. Use only the adapter supplied with the router. 7. Check the LEDs: · The M1 LED should turn on and after a few seconds it should start BLINKING · The M2 LED should turn OFF, if this light stays on this usually indicates a hardware problem, in this case please contact Sitecom support. · The WAN LED must be ON. · For each active LAN connection, the associated LAN Link/Act LED must be ON. 2 PC Setup 1 Set up TCP/IP 1. Windows 98/ME Right click the Network Neighbourhood icon on the desktop and click Properties. The following window will be displayed: Windows 2000/XP Right click the My Network Places icon on the desktop and click Properties. The following window will be displayed: Right click the Local Area Connection of the correct network card, and then choose Properties. 3 2 If the list that appears on screen does not include a line, such as the one that has been selected above ("TCP/IP -> network card"), then follow the steps indicated below to add this line: · Click on the button "Add" · Double - click on "Protocol" · Select "Microsoft" and thereafter "TCP/IP" · Click on "OK" · Wait a few seconds, so that TCP/IP can be added. Thereafter, click "OK" to leave the network properties screen. Restart your PC. 3 Select the line "TCP/IP -> Network card" as shown above. Click on the button Properties to obtain a window similar to the following: 4 Check whether the setting "Obtain an IP address automatically" has been selected, as is illustrated above. The DHCP server in the broadband router will now assign an IP address to the PC. Restart your PC, even if you have not made any changes. 2 Internet access Windows 98/ME/2000 · In the Taskbar, click on the Start button and select Settings - Control Panel - Internet options. · Select the tab Connections and click on the button Settings. · Select "I want to configure my Internet connection manually" or "I want to make a connection via a LAN network" and click on "Next >". · Select "I want to connect via a LAN network" and click on "Next >". · Check carefully that all of the checkboxes in the screen Internet configuration for a LAN have not been checked. · Continue with the steps in the wizard, until the task is completed. The PC configuration is now completed. 4 Windows XP · In the Taskbar, click on the Start button and select - Settings - Control Panel - Internet options. · Select the tab Connections and click the Setup... button. · When the New Connection Wizard starts, click on Next. · Select Connect to internet and click on Next. · Select Set up my connection manually and click on Next. · Select Connect using a broadband connection that is always on and click on Next. · Click on Finish to close the Wizard. · In the Taskbar, click on the Start button and select - Settings - Control Panel - Internet options. · Select the Connections tab and click on the LAN Settings button. · Check carefully that none of the boxes in the Local Area Network (LAN) Settings window are checked. The PC configuration is now completed. Router setup Manual configuration - Internet access 1 Ensure you have TCP/IP settings on your PC, as described above. Do not forget to restart your PC after you have finished. 2 Start your web browser. In the Address field, enter the following: http://192.168.123.254 3 Login with the username admin and password admin. 4. The start up window will now be displayed. Click on Wizard. 5. The Setup wizard will now be displayed; check that the modem is connected and click on Next. 5 6 Select your country from the Country list. 7 From Service, select your internet provider. Click Next. 8 Depending on the chosen provider, you may need to enter your user name and password and MAC address or hostname in the following window. Then click on Next. 6 9 Click Reboot to complete the configuration. 10 The configuration is now completed. If your provider does not appear in the list, consult the full manual to find out how you can configure the router for your connection. 11 Click OK to reboot the router and commit the changes. 12 If you are using a PPTP or PPPoE connection please click Connect in the following window. 13 The router will now connect to the Internet. 7 Wireless settings To change the settings of your wireless network please follow the steps below: · Start your web browser. In the Address field, enter the following: http://192.168.123.254 · Login with the username admin and password admin. · Go to Basic settings->Wireless · Change the settings according to your wishes. · Network ID (SSID): The SSID is an unique ID used by Access Point and stations to identify a wireless LAN. Make sure all wireless stations and Access Points have the same SSID. The SSID can be set up to 32 characters and is case sensitive. · Channel: Enables you to change the channel of the wireless network. Every channel corresponds with a different frequency in the 2.4Ghz band. · Encryption: By default None is selected. This means encryption is not enabled. See the next chapter for more information about encryption. · Click Save to save the changes. · Click Reboot to activate the changes you have made. 8 Advanced wireless settings - Encryption Data Encryption lets you enable encryption and set the encryption keys, making your data transmissions in your wireless network more secure. The WL-114 supports a wide range of encryption algorithms including the latest WPA standard. Note Before setting up encryption, make sure your wireless clients support the encryption type you want to use. While almost all wireless adapters will support WEP encryption there are still a few which do not support WPA encryption. If you use an encryption type which your wireless clients do not support, they will not be able to communicate with the router, resulting in a loss of network connection. WEP WEP- encryption is the simplest form of encryption and uses a single static key to encrypt and decrypt all traffic between your router and wireless clients. To set up WEP encryption follow these steps: · Select WEP · Select the encryption strength, 64-bit, 128-bit, or 256 -bit. The higher the bit count, the stronger the encryption. · Enter the key you wish to use for encryption in the WEP Key 1 text field. See the follow table for valid WEP key formats: 64 bit 128 bit 256 bit hexadecimal hexadecimal hexadecimal 10 characters 26 characters 58 characters A- F & 0 -9 A- F & 0 -9 A- F & 0 -9 · Click Save to save the changes. · Click Reboot to activate the changes you have made. 9 WPA-PSK WPA is the official successor to WEP encryption featuring a more advanced encryption algorithm and making use of dynamic encryption keys providing a much more secured wireless connection. If possible you should use this encryption type. To set up WPA- PSK encryption follow these steps: · Select WPA- PSK · · · · Select which type of encryption key you wish to use; ASCII or HEX. Enter your encryption key. Unlike WEP encryption, a WPA- PSK encryption key can be of any length. Click Save to save the changes. Click Reboot to activate the changes you have made. 10
